1. Problem Description

We are given a diagram with two parallel lines intersected by a transversal. One angle is labeled as 8282^{\circ}, and another angle is labeled as xx. We need to find the value of xx.

2. Solution Steps

The 8282^{\circ} angle and the angle xx are consecutive interior angles.
Consecutive interior angles are supplementary, meaning their sum is 180180^{\circ}.
Therefore, we can write the equation:
x+82=180x + 82^{\circ} = 180^{\circ}
Subtracting 8282^{\circ} from both sides, we get:
x=18082x = 180^{\circ} - 82^{\circ}
x=98x = 98^{\circ}

3. Final Answer

x=98x = 98^{\circ}
